Oh brother
Dear brother,
How do I even begin to describe all that you’ve done for me,
I know you felt like you haven’t been there much when we were younger,
But I was just a kid, and you had a lot going on at the time,
We always got along, I always knew I had the greatest brother,
Once you moved out it did feel empty in that tiny room,
You were the best roommate I ever had,
I wish you weren’t much older,
You’ve just seen me at my lowest,
Opening up to you was the greatest thing,
You were always so supportive,
You are my role model, always will be,
A second father to me,
I hate how emotional I get,
Even thinking about all the great memories,
And I just want time to stop,
Or maybe go back in time,
To relive those moments when we would just go outside on a Summer day and play soccer,
Together, when our only worry would be when the sun went down,
Just you and I,
But I’m already 20 and you’re already 30, and no matter what,
I will never be able to talk about you without shedding a tear,
For losing you is my biggest fear.
Sincerely,
Your baby brother, Serg
